BREAKING🚨: In a loss for the Biden administration, The Supreme Court on Tuesday allowed Texas to enforce a contentious new law that gives local police the power to arrest migrants.

The conservative-majority court, with three liberal justices dissenting, rejected an emergency request made by the Biden administration, which said states have no authority to legislate on immigration, an issue the federal government has sole authority over.

Three military officials who worked in the Trump Admin, Secretary Robert Wilkie, Lt General Keith Kellogg, and Lt General William “Jerry” Boykin, have made a filing with the SCOTUS arguing that the military WOULD NOT obey an order to assassinate a President’s political opponent AND that it would be illegal for such an order to be carried out.
